What to check before for good cause buildings near the B62 bus in Queens

  • Search within reach of the B62 bus corridor, then narrow further by good cause protections to guide how the building should handle renewals and certain rent increases.
  • Before applying, confirm the lease terms in writing: renewal language, rent-increase provisions, and any stated limits tied to the good cause framework.
  • Check the building’s unit policy details directly (fees, utilities, parking, laundry, move-in requirements) since these can differ even when the building category is the same.
  • Compare deposits and the full monthly cost beyond the asking rent (utilities, any required payments, and any broker-related costs) when budgeting.
